Animals in the City
- At Haltiala Farm you can see farm animals on outdoor pastures even in winter. The farm also has a playground. The farm's indoor facilities are closed during winter break. Free entry.
- Fallkullan Farm's barn, stables and indoor facilities are open to visitors during winter break only on Sunday 15.2 and Sunday 22.2.2026 10 am-2 pm.
Free entry. However, Fallkullan Farm's outdoor areas can be accessed freely at other times as well.
- A picnic trip to the Winter Garden also works during winter break and the garden's carp swim under the palms in the warmth. The Winter Garden on the north side of Töölönlahti is open during winter break Monday to Thursday 10 am-4 pm and Saturday and Sunday 10 am-4 pm. Closed Fridays! Free entry.
- Husön Riding School's horses can sometimes be seen along the Talosaari outdoor trail (owned by Helsinki city) also during winter season. The area has a partially accessible outdoor trail.
- Korkeasaari Zoo is open normally during winter break week. Zoo admission fee.

- Helsinki's perhaps most stunning viewpoint is now more easily accessible, as the old oil tank on top of Kruunuvuori cliff now has stairs! Access to the stairs is from Koirasaarentiie, near the start of Kruunusiltas.

- Kruunuvuoren waterfront has many other adventure spots!
- Old Kaivoskalli quarries are now easier to explore with new boardwalks and stairs! The route starts from Koirasaarentiie, at a corner near old cottages across from Stansvikintie intersection.
- Onnentemppeli cottage is an amazing picnic spot at Stansvik!
- Stansvik grill spot by the shore near the restaurant (restaurant closed in winter).
- Kruunuvuori's magical pond is now also more accessible with new boardwalk routes. The accessible route starts from Kultakruununkaar, the more challenging route from Päätiie.
- Also remember the great playgrounds: at Kruunuvuoren waterfront sports park (including skating rink!) and in the north part of Haakoninlahti Park (next to school construction site with big machinery!).
- Uunisaari island in front of Kaivopuisto has a bridge connection during winter months and you can gaze toward the horizon on the rocky island, watch passing ships and shore waves, and listen to ice floes sounds.
- For a self-guided winter trip it's worth heading along boardwalks to places like Lammassaari island, Suomenlinna fortress, Seurasaari island, and Pukkisaari island, Matosaari island, Tullisaari island and Kivinokka trails. - Grilling spots have been built in areas like Tullisaari Manor Park in Laajasalo and Stansvik. You need to bring your own charcoal/firewood. Older grilling spots can be found at Uutela, Seurasaari and Kallahdennie beach in Vuosaari. Uutela shelter is presumably open at least for part of the winter break (opening days are updated on the shelter's Facebook page) and Paloheinä outdoor area's grill shelter is open (as far as I know) every day.
- Also remember: Pienten Suomi - over 1000 reasons to travel in Finland with children!
- Sipoonkorpi has for example an easy-access Tasakallio - Storträsk route and Byabäcken nature trail, previously known as Ponun traditional mail trail, which leads to a grill spot and shelter to warm up. Tip from experience: with small children, the Byabäcken route is best walked from the start to the grill spot and back the same way, rather than circling the route as it partly runs along a road. Grilling spot usually has plenty of ready firewood, so bring matches and snacks. However, note that some routes may be very slippery and difficult to access in winter.
- The route from Kuusijärvi to Sipoonkorpi is worth trying and experiencing a nice bridge route into the national park.
